OpenVPN offers several SMB and enterprise pricing plans covered both per year or against a single-payment license. The details are as follows:
- 1 Year – $15.00/one-time payment
- 2 Years – $28.50/one-time payment
- 3 Years – $40.50/one-time payment
- 4 Years – $51.00/one-time payment
- 5 Years – $60.00/one-time payment
Licensing is per client connection. A minimum purchase of 10 licenses is required.

Atlas VPN offers three plans for users to choose from, which are available in a subscription-based pricing model. Atlas VPN also has free version which allows you to access and use a limited number of VPN servers and features at no cost. Here are the enterprise pricing details:
Free
- 3 Server locations
- Unlimited concurrent connections
- Unlimited bandwidth
- 5 GB of data/month
Premium
1 Month – $10.99 for the 1st month
1 Year – $39.42 for the 1st year ($3.29/month)
Three Years – $71.49 for the 1st 3 years ($1.99/month)
Premium Features & Benefits:
- 750+ VPN servers in 43 location
- Unlimited devices and data
- No-logs privacy policy
- Data breach tracking
- Secure VPN encryption
- Third-party tracker monitoring
- High-quality streaming and gaming
- Privacy-optimized servers
- VPN apps for Android TV and Amazon Fire TV
- 24/7 technical support
